New Zealand central bank chief told to ‘stay in her lane’ after backing US Fed’s Powell

New Zealand Foreign Affairs Minister Winston Peters rebuked the country’s new Reserve Bank governor, Anna Breman, for wading into US domestic politics after she signed a statement with other global central bankers backing Federal Reserve Chair Jerome Powell. “The RBNZ has no role, nor should it involve itself, in US domestic politics.
